Default GS300 Rear control arm help

So I recently acquired this vehicle (1995 Lexus GS300) and it began to shake as I drove it, had a buddy look at the car and he told me it was the upper control arm for both sides on the rear of the vehicle.
The wheels wobble and I don't know if its just the bushing, or the entire upper. Either way can anyone give me some information on this piece and where it may be acquired? I have found a few things online that look promising but mostly they are diagrams of the entire rear suspension and im not 100% sure what to get, where to get it or if this part is actually going to cost me 500-800$ a piece...

Default Might also look at your rear sub frame bushings

Mine were shot in my 95 and the rear end would start to shake like a wet dog. Also if it feels like your tail is a bit loose around corners, check those bushings. Same thing we do on MK3 Supra's, same great results

My rear bushings on the control arms are shot. Causes the car to wobble side to side at highway speeds. I was going to get super pro bushings as I have replaced ALL lower bushings with super pro front and rear, but with 430k miles on the car, decided to get new arms as I am sure the ball joints are probably worn as well. Found these for $130 shipped for the pair. Hopefully they hold up for the rest of the time I have the car.
